About 100,000 ultra-orthodox Jews took to the streets of Israel on Thursday to protest a Supreme Court decision sentencing 40 ultra-orthodox parents to prison for contempt of court.
...The Ashkenazi Jews, from the Hasidic sect, one of Judaism’s strictest and most traditional, insisted that their daughters not mix at the school with the Sephardic girls, whom they consider to be from a less-doctrinaire practice.
...High birth rates and highly disciplined voting ranks have given the ultra-orthodox disproportionate and rapidly growing political influence in Israel. That, combined with the fact that many ultra-orthodox refuse to serve in the army, even as they receive hefty state support to devote themselves to torah study has kindled resentment among secular Israelis.
